So I went into Visual Studio 2008 and found some code that uses new and hit 'F1' and received this tidbit:
Quote: Remarks
This form of operator new is known as scalar new, in contrast to the vector new form (operator new[]).
The first form of this operator is known as the nonplacement form. The second form of this operator is known as the placement form and the third form of this operator is the nonthrowing, placement form.
The first form of the operator is defined by the compiler and does not require new.h to be included in your program.
operator delete frees memory allocated with operator new.
You can configure whether operator new returns null or throws an exception on failure. See The new and delete Operators for more information.
With the exception of throwing or no-throwing behavior, the CRT operator new behaves like operator new in the Standard C++ Library.
So, since you can apparently configure the action on failure, I'm guessing that the MFC / Wizard code is defending against the case where it *doesn't* throw an exception (wow, now I'm channelling Bill Gates).
I didn't follow the links to *how* one would configure the behavior or what the default behavior is now-a-days. I suggest you set the behavior the way you want it (or take the default) and write your code accordingly.

The C++ standard requires that the new operator throws upon failure, but MS for some unknown reason implemented their compiler otherwise: it will return 0 upon failure and not throw.
In short, Visual C++ is not standard compliant, in this, and various other things, mostly related to templates. If you code platform-independent, you will have to specifically take care of these discrepancies, but since you are using MFC, I suppose that is not the case.
|
|
|
|
|
In this case, the compiler is not at fault. Since VC2005, Visual C++ compilers have been good at adhering to the standard, and has largely been at par with the other compilers out there in that regard.
In VC2008, new throws as it should, but the code in the question above is automatically generated, and that generator has apparently not been updated since the bad old days of VC6.0
Since Herb Sutter - the convener of the C++ standards committee - started working for Microsoft as an architect in the developer tools division, they have spent a lot of time and effort on becoming standards-compliant, and you do them a disservice to claim that the recent compilers are as bad as the steaming pile of wossname that VC6 is.
